 A Foster Teen Has Gone Missing. Why, His Family Asks, is No One Looking for Him?

On September 25, 16-year-old Vincent Chavez—Junior, as his family calls him—ran away from his aunt’s house, where the New Mexico Children, Youth and Families Department had placed him and five of his siblings in foster care the month before.
